We help you...

  1. Prepare an initial business plan to spell out your marketing, management, and financial plans.

  2. Determine your startup capital needs.

  3. Identify potential sources of startup capital and backup money sources also, if needed.

  4. Evaluate and quantify your borrowing power so you know how much money you can get your hands on if you end up needing it.

  5. Select a specific business structure that most adequately fits your needs by analyzing tax advantages, legal threats, ease of operation and portability in case you want or need to relocate.

  6. Select the right accounting software by analyzing your budget, needs and hardware.

  7. Put together a Cash Flow Budget so you know exactly how much money you need to keep the business running each month for the first few years. Unplanned cash requirements can be very emotionally draining when they come up.

  8. Establish collection and billing procedures to maximize your cash flow.

  9. Com up with procedures to monitor and control costs.

  10. Plan to set up a home office so you can maximize your tax deductions.

  11. Prepare and file all required Utah State and local licenses and permits.

  12. Prepare and file your application for your Federal Employer Identification Number.

  13. Provide payroll and payroll tax filing when you hire your first employee.

  14. Comply with State & Federal employment laws so you don't get hit with fines and unhappy employees.

  15. Identify your business insurance needs.

  16. Create a solid Partnership Agreement. This is an very important document for all new partnerships and will help prevent a large amount of financial  problems down the road.
